Understanding Low-VOC Paints
When you pick low-VOC paints, you're choosing an item that emits fewer volatile organic substances, which can be dangerous to both your health and wellness and the setting.
VOCs are chemicals found in numerous paint items that can vaporize right into the air and add to interior air pollution. By selecting low-VOC alternatives, you're decreasing the variety of these discharges, making your space much safer.
Low-VOC paints normally have 50 grams per liter or fewer VOCs, compared to conventional paints that can include as much as 250 grams per litre. This implies that when you paint your home with low-VOC items, you're not just deciding for looks; you're likewise taking a step in the direction of a much healthier indoor atmosphere.

Possible Downsides to Think About
While low-VOC paints supply various advantages, there are some prospective drawbacks to remember. One considerable issue is their efficiency compared to typical paints. Low-VOC alternatives might not constantly supply the same level of sturdiness and coverage, which can lead to more constant touch-ups or a demand for extra layers. This can be discouraging and taxing throughout your paint job.
Another concern is the drying time. Low-VOC paints commonly take longer to completely dry than their high-VOC counterparts, which can prolong your project timeline. If you get on a limited timetable, this may be a disadvantage to think about.
You should also understand that low-VOC paints can occasionally have a various coating or appearance. If you're aiming for a details visual, make certain to evaluate samples to make sure the result meets your assumptions.
Last but not least, while low-VOC paints are generally much safer, they can still produce some fumes. Appropriate ventilation is crucial during and after application, so be prepared to air out your area effectively.
